The FiveTen impact II's are going to look almost exactly like the black leather ones with the white trim on jvnixon's Sicklines.com

In addition there will be 2 "Special Editions":

One will be the Sam Hill low-top, and the other will be the Nathan Rennine high-top. These will also look almost exactly like the ones from Interbike on Sicklines.com

Pretty cool. No word yet on the armored toe-box, but last I heard, they were talking about making one, and I REALLY hope they do.
